Rule 3.15. Financial Disclosure Statements
D. A filer may amend a financial disclosure statement at any time to correct a bona fide oversight or error, provided the filer certifies that the amendment is not made for the purpose of reporting information that was intentionally omitted or misstated on a prior filed statement. If the filer files an amendment that is not in fact made for the purpose of reporting information that was intentionally omitted or misstated, the filer shall not be deemed to have violated these Rules by having made an erroneous prior filing.
